TOP 5 EYE MAKEUP TRENDS FOR SPRING
The new beauty season is here! We round up five of the top eye makeup trends, as spotted on the spring catwalks.
WE’VE GOT THE BLUES
If you only got room for one new colour in
your spring palette, let it be blue. It was on every spring catwalk –
from bold mono shades in cobalt blue to more discreet, pastel
eyeliners. We also saw a disco-inspired take on the trend, with
metallic, turquoise shades.
KRAZY FOR KOHL
Eyeliner, and in particular eyeliner on the
waterline, provided a cool contrast to the fresh-faced, natural look
we saw on many catwalks. Be liberal with your eyeliner, but leave the
rest of your face neutral. Hair is important in this look too; play
with its natural texture for a loose, almost bohemian style. Think
hippie-luxe with a grungy twist.
LASHING OUT
Clumpy, spidery mascara, exaggerated lengths, wispy
falsies. This season was all about the lashes. And please, do go ahead
and try this at home – this trend is more about experimenting,
embracing the imperfect.
TIME TO SHINE
Glitter is a huge trend this season. You might
associate metallic shades with New Year and the party season, but
glitter works just as well for the lighter months. We love a more
subtle, soft and romantic take on the trend – dab lightly on your
eyelids for best results.
SUBTLE SIXTIES
If you’re not that krazy for kohl but still like
to add a little drama to your look – this is the trend for you.
Minimalist, yet striking lines of black eyeliner left an impact on the
spring catwalks. Leave the rest of your eyes rather naked, and match
with a fresh face and red lips.
